Notes from the Tuesday stand-up: the score sheets from the Gorsefield Regional Chess Final are finally boxed and ready to move. Dispatch desk to slot them on Thursday's southbound run — tournament office at Kellwick wants originals, not scans. Arbiter Milo Frayne already signed the release. One sealed box, light, fragile-ish. At hand-over, follow the confidential line below.

handover note for hafop-bagug: the holok frair courier leaves the rusvan novmir eliix gilath oliiel kasix eliax wenmir ledger at gate 3383 under passcode 753647

### 3.2.0 — Changed defaults

Podkettle, our feed validator, now rejects feeds with missing episode GUIDs by default instead of warning. The strictness flag that previously shipped as permissive is now set to enforce, and the fetch timeout was shortened to reduce queue stalls. If you're onboarding, note that older docs show the pre-3.2 values. The new default configuration is as follows.

deployment values, fahap-hahaf:
[casdor]
port = 9200
region = south-2
host = casdor.qirvanworks.corp
timeout_ms = 3000
retries = 4

## Further Reading

Nocturne is the scheduler that kicks off nightly backfills for the Harpwell warehouse. Before editing any job definitions, read up on dependency fences and the retry budget — misconfigured fences are the top cause of duplicate backfills. New contractors should also review the dry-run workflow. The architecture overview and job-authoring guide are kept on the internal page below.

wiki page, hahif-hahif: https://argocd.kelvisys.corp/browse/board/settings/pages/1442e0b1065d83f1

## Cold Starts

Quillhop handlers cold-start in 2–4 s. Acceptable for batch, not for webhook paths. Release checklist: keep the warmer schedule enabled, pin handler memory at the tested tier, and never ship a release that adds imports to the entrypoint without rerunning the cold-start bench. Warm pool state lives in the metrics store; connect with the string below.

warehouse DSN: clickhouse://druys_svc:Pl@db-47e1.orvexstack.corp:5432/beldor